### Locker door fails to release after valid scan

In the Tumblebin laundry-locker flow, a valid customer scan triggers a release request to the hinge controller. If the door stays locked, first confirm the controller received the request by checking the relay log. A 401 response means the gateway's service credential expired — the controller rotates these every six hours, and clock drift on the edge device can invalidate them early. To replay the release request manually against staging, authenticate with the token below.

session JWT of yawep-yawep = eyJhbGciOiJIUzI1NiIsInR5cCI6IkpXVCJ9.eyJzdWIiOiI3pWF3_In0.aXYsHiog

### Changelog — Pinecrest Search, relevance tuning (v2.8)

Hey support folks: we nudged the relevance weights again. Exact title matches now rank above fuzzy synonyms, and stale listings get a mild demotion. If customers report "weird results," grab the query and check it against the tuning notes in the wiki first. Escalations about ranking behavior should go straight to the owner listed here.

approver of yawig-yajef = Briius Jorix

## Alert Deduplicator (Grayfen pager pipeline)

Incoming alerts are hashed on source, check name, and severity, then folded into an open group within a sliding window. Groups close on quiet timeout or max size, whichever hits first. Suppressed duplicates increment a counter on the group rather than paging. Reviewer note: windowing is wall-clock, not event-time, deliberately. Tuning lives in these constants.

tuning table, hafog-bahaf:
QUOTAS = {
    "praion": 144,
    "briax": 906,
    "silwyn": 451,
}